What underlies the economies of the leading European countries?

Since European countries themselves are no longer rich in resources, the economy is based on the production of products and the improvement of technologies. Therefore, the issue of attracting brains from abroad is especially important for these countries. Also, the countries produce large amounts of electricity and successfully trade with each other. Trade is also an important part of the European economy, and it is for this reason that the countries have merged into the European Union for more successful trade and economic development.
